BAKU DESIGNATED CAPITAL OF ISLAMIC CULTURE FOR 2009
Azerbaijani delegation led by Minister of Culture and Tourism Abulfaz Garayev attended the Fifth Islamic Conference of Culture Ministers in Tripoli, Libya.
During the conference, participants adopted decision to hold the 6th Islamic Conference of Culture Ministers in Baku, in 2009. Besides, national report on use of the cultural strategy of Islamic world in the Republic of Azerbaijan worked out by Azerbaijan’s Ministry of Culture and Tourism was put on conference agenda. Director General of the Islamic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(ISESCO) Abdulaziz Othman Altwaijri strongly condemned the Armenia’s occupation policy against Azerbaijan.
The conference participants adopted a resolution on safeguarding the cultural heritage of the Islamic world.
They expressed satisfaction with Conference “Youth For Alliance of Civilizations” held in Baku on November 2007 as well as welcomed the First International Conference “Woman’s role in intercultural dialogue” to be hosted in Azerbaijani capital in 2008 by Mrs. Mehriban Aliyeva, UNESCO and ISESCO Goodwill Ambassador and President of the Heydar Aliyev Foundation.
During the conference, Mr. Garayev also met with ISESCO Director General, Culture Ministers of Libya, Egypt, Iran, Morocco and others to discuss the prospects of further cooperation.
